 U.S. Monster Employment Index
Launched in April 2004 with data collected since October 2003, the Monster Employment Index is a broad and comprehensive monthly analysis of U.S. online job demand conducted by Monster Worldwide, Inc.
Based on a real-time review of employer job opportunities culled from a large, representative selection of corporate career sites and job boards, including Monster, the Monster Employment Index presents a snapshot of employer online recruitment activity nationwide.

Monster Local Employment Index
The Monster Local Employment Index presents a snapshot of employer online recruitment activity in the top 28 U.S. markets with the largest working populations. In an effort to present a single, comprehensive snapshot of U.S. national and local online recruitment trends each month, findings for the top 28 U.S. metro markets are reported as part of the monthly findings of the national Monster Employment Index.
Monthly data tables for each of the 28 markets will be made available for download on the same day the Monster Employment Index findings are published.

Monster Employment Index Europe
The Monster Employment Index Europe provides country-specific data measuring online job demand in France, Germany, the Netherlands, Sweden, and the United Kingdom. Monthly findings are based on a real-time review of employer job opportunities culled from a large, representative selection of corporate career sites and job boards, including Monster®, believed to be representative of employer activity within the five countries.

Monster Employment Index Canada
The Monster Employment Index Canada provides Canadian labour market watchers with a quarterly snapshot of online job demand across Canada. The Index offers a comprehensive measurement of online job availability by province, city and occupations based on real-time data culled from Monster Canada and other major Web sites believed to be representative of employer online recruitment activity nationwide.
As the first Index to measure Canadian online hiring activity on a national scale, the Monster Employment Index Canada provides a new perspective on job availability presently not covered by a standard metric. Compared to existing indices, the Index highlights the continuously growing trend toward the Internet as the recruiting medium of choice for both companies and candidates.
